The recently concluded handlooms and handicraft fair in Bhubaneswar has attracted spot orders for Rs 7 million worth of goods from foreign buyers.
The fair which was held over two days from February 24, attracted buyers from 33 overseas countries which include US, France, Poland, Netherland, Spain, Brazil and New Zealand.
Talks are also underway which could see orders for Rs 10 million fructifying in the next few days, according to Ms Arti Ahuja, Secretary in the Orissa Handloom and Handicrafts department.
